Baseball Edged By Norfolk State, 5-2

Conor Kiely extended his hit streak to nine games (Photo Credit: Michael Sudhalter).

NORFOLK, Va. (April 1, 2023)- The Stonehill College baseball team kicked off game two of three Saturday against Norfolk State where the Skyhawks ended up falling, 5-2 at Marty Miller Field.

Key Moments

  • Stonehill started off the scoring again in the first inning. Today's first run was thanks to smart base running after a wild pitch from the Spartans that allowed Kiely to score. 
  • Later in the contest, the Skyhawks tacked on another run when Flaherty drove a single through the left side and brought home Sam Parks after he drew a walk earlier in the inning.
  • For the first four innings, Matt Tyman kept the hosts at bay by not allowing one run despite Norfolk State registering eight hits. The hosts threatened in the fourth when they had runners at second and third with one out. However, Tyman got out of the jam after he induced a ground and flyout to keep the squad out in front. 
  • In the fifth, Norfolk State cut the deficit to one when Raphael Rodriguez hit a sacrifice to right and made it a 2-1 ballgame. The Spartans ended up pulling ahead later in the seventh with a four-run inning to go up 5-2 highlighted by a Justin Journette three-run homer.
  • Despite being down three, Stonehill generated a rally when Mike Swanholm reached first after a Spartans error and Stonehill had runners on first and second after Flaherty singled to lead off the inning. After Chris Roberti was hit by a pitch, the Purple and White had the bases loaded with one out. Unfortunately, Norfolk State's pitching ended the rally by retiring the next two batters.
  • Stonehill would once again threaten in the ninth after Parks drew his third walk of the day but the Spartans pitching once again bailed out Norfolk State as the hosts held on for the 5-2 win.

Up Next

Stonehill and Norfolk State wrap up the final game of their three-game Northeast Conference set tomorrow afternoon at noon.
